Letitia Dean is to reprise her 'EastEnders' role of Sharon Rickman on a one-year contract.
Letitia Dean is returning to 'EastEnders'.
The 44-year-old actress has signed a 12-month contract to reprise her role as Sharon Rickman in the BBC One soap and can't wait to return to Albert Square.
She said: "I'm looking forward to being part of the 'EastEnders' team again.
"It has always been very close to my heart. I cannot wait to work with my old colleagues and see what is in store for Sharon."
Executive producer Bryan Kirkwood added: "I'm thrilled that Letitia is coming back home to Albert Square where she belongs.
"Sharon is a real favourite amongst 'EastEnders' fans and I for one can't wait until she arrives back in the summer."
The details of Sharon's return are being kept closely under wraps but have been described as "epic".
Letitia - one of the show's original cast members - is making her third return to 'EastEnders' as Sharon.
Her character left Albert Square in 1996 following an affair with her husband Grant Mitchell's brother Phil and she then returned as Queen Vic landlady in 2001.
She left again in 2006 following the death of husband Dennis Rickman - the son of her adopted father Den Watts - and the character was pregnant at the time of her exit.
